“Vipertech Airsoft” Replica Maintenance and Optimization Tips
Proper maintenance and optimization are crucial for maximizing the lifespan and performance of these high-end airsoft replicas. The following tips provide guidance on ensuring reliable operation and preserving the value of the investment.
Tip 1: Regular Cleaning and Lubrication: Implement a consistent cleaning schedule after each use. Disassemble the replica and thoroughly clean the internal components, removing any debris or residue. Apply appropriate lubricants, such as silicone oil, to reduce friction and prevent wear. Avoid over-lubrication, as it can attract dirt and negatively impact performance.
Tip 2: Magazine Maintenance: Regularly inspect magazines for damage or leaks. Disassemble and clean the magazine internals, ensuring smooth follower movement. Lubricate gas magazines with silicone oil to prevent O-ring degradation. Properly store magazines when not in use to prevent pressure loss.
Tip 3: Gas System Optimization: Optimize the gas system for consistent performance. Ensure proper gas pressure for the specific replica and environmental conditions. Replace worn or damaged O-rings and seals to prevent gas leaks. Consider using a high-quality regulator for precise pressure control.
Tip 4: Hop-Up Adjustment: Regularly adjust the hop-up unit to achieve optimal range and accuracy. Experiment with different hop-up settings based on BB weight and engagement distance. Avoid over-hopping, which can cause BBs to curve excessively. Consider upgrading the hop-up bucking for improved performance.
Tip 5: Component Inspection and Replacement: Periodically inspect critical components for wear or damage. Pay close attention to the nozzle, piston, and trigger group. Replace any worn or damaged parts with OEM or high-quality aftermarket components to maintain reliable operation.
Tip 6: Storage Considerations: Store these airsoft replicas in a dry, protected environment. Avoid exposing them to extreme temperatures or humidity, which can damage internal components. Consider using a padded case or gun safe for secure storage.
Adhering to these maintenance and optimization tips will significantly enhance the longevity, reliability, and performance of these airsoft replicas, ensuring a more enjoyable and effective experience.

1. Steel construction
The utilization of steel in the construction of these airsoft replicas is a defining characteristic, differentiating them from many other products in the market. This choice of material directly impacts durability, weight, and overall realism, contributing significantly to the value proposition.
- Receiver Durability
The receiver, often the central component of these replicas, is frequently constructed from stamped or machined steel. This provides exceptional resistance to wear and tear, withstanding the stresses of repeated use in demanding environments. Polymer or alloy receivers, common in less expensive models, are more susceptible to cracking or deformation under similar conditions.
- Barrel Assembly Rigidity
Steel barrels and barrel assemblies contribute to improved accuracy and consistency. The rigidity of steel minimizes barrel flex during firing, maintaining a more stable platform for projectile launch. This is especially crucial in longer-range engagements where slight variations in barrel alignment can significantly impact point of impact.
- Internal Component Longevity
Many internal components, such as gears, sears, and triggers, are also manufactured from steel. This enhances their resistance to wear and tear from repeated cycling and friction. Steel internals translate to a longer service life and reduced maintenance requirements compared to replicas with polymer or alloy internals.
- Weight and Realism
The increased weight associated with steel construction contributes significantly to the overall realism of these airsoft replicas. The heft and feel of a steel-bodied replica more closely approximates that of a real firearm, enhancing the immersion and training value for users seeking a realistic experience.
These factors collectively reinforce the significance of steel construction in these airsoft replicas. By prioritizing durability, rigidity, and realism, the use of steel differentiates these products from competitors and caters to a specific niche within the airsoft market that values authenticity and long-term performance.
2. Realistic Operation
The emphasis on realistic operation is a cornerstone of these high-end airsoft replicas, significantly contributing to their value and appeal within the airsoft community. This focus extends beyond mere aesthetics, encompassing functional mechanics and user interaction closely mirroring real firearms.
- Functional Bolt Carrier Groups
A primary aspect of realistic operation involves fully functional bolt carrier groups. These components cycle in a manner analogous to their real-world counterparts, creating recoil and requiring manipulation for reloading. This feature is critical for training scenarios and enhances the overall immersive experience. For example, the need to manually charge the replica after inserting a fresh magazine replicates the procedural actions required with a real firearm.
- Realistic Disassembly Procedures
These airsoft replicas often feature disassembly procedures that closely match the processes used with real firearms. This allows users to familiarize themselves with the internal components and their arrangement, valuable for maintenance and training purposes. The ability to field-strip and clean the replica contributes to a greater understanding of firearm mechanics, surpassing the superficial realism of static display models.
- Magazine Capacity and Reloading
The magazine capacity of these replicas often corresponds to the real-world counterparts they emulate. Realistic reloading procedures, including the need to lock back the bolt and manually release it after inserting a fresh magazine, are also incorporated. These details contribute to the authenticity of the training experience, reinforcing proper firearm handling techniques.
- Trigger Mechanics and Recoil Simulation
Efforts are often made to replicate the trigger pull weight and feel of real firearms. This, coupled with simulated recoil mechanisms, provides a more realistic shooting experience. The tactile feedback and responsive trigger contribute to improved accuracy and a more engaging training environment, surpassing the feel of standard airsoft triggers.
These elements of realistic operation, integrated into the design and function of these replicas, directly contribute to their premium status within the airsoft market. They appeal to users seeking a high degree of authenticity for training, simulation, or historical reenactment purposes, setting these products apart from more conventional airsoft offerings. The combination of visual fidelity and functional realism elevates the user experience and justifies the higher price point associated with these meticulously crafted replicas.
